Introducing Playback Rental Previews. Now you can get a full MultiTrack preview of an entire song in the Playback app, before spending a rental to unlock the tracks for performance use. It's super simple to get started, the the previews are already included in your Playback Rentals subscription!


Before Getting Started:

What is a Playback Rental Preview?
A Playback Rental Preview allows access to a song's tracks for 30 days. Every track in any key, available in Playback to setup arrangements, mixes and more. Playback Rental Previews will contain a watermark and are limited to a single mono output. The song can be rented at any point to remove the preview limitations.

How many songs can I preview?

Playback Rental Previews are granted based on the Playback Rentals subscription tier. For every rental granted, there is one rental preview granted. If you're on an annual 16/month rental plan (208 rentals), you'll receive the same amount of Rental Previews; 208.

Are Playback Rental Previews device specific?
Unlike Playback Rentals, Playback Rental Previews are not device specific, and once unlocked, any admin or user with Playback Rentals permission and a Playback Premium seat from the organization, can access the Playback Rental previews on their own device(s).

Do Playback Rental Previews cost any more money? Can I get more Playback Rental Previews?
Playback Rental Previews are connected to the Playback Rentals tier. Increasing your Playback Rentals tier is the only way to add more Playback Rental Previews.

Who can Access Playback Rental Previews?
Anyone user on an organization both Playback Rental permission, and a Playback Premium seat can access Playback Rental Previews to help prep setlists well-in-advance from setlist dates.


How to add a Playback Rental Preview

Adding a Playback Rental Preview is simple. Simply select the "Preview" tab when loading or adding the songs or setlists into Playback.

When Adding new songs to a setlist in Playback

Before adding the song rental, just select the "Preview" tab. Then select all of your arrangement settings, and then click "Preview" to start the download of the preview tracks. The preview will immediately start to download all of the preview tracks.

If the "Preview" tab is not showing on your device, please make sure you meeting the following requirements:

  • Playback app is up to date on the most recent version (8.5.0 or higher)

  • You are assigned Playback Rental Permission from the People Page on MultiTracks.com

  • You are assigned a Playback Premium seat from the People Page on MultiTracks.com

When loading an already created setlist

When loading a setlist with content that you don't own, or haven't rented yet, you'll be prompted to rent or preview the content. The popup will look like this, with options to either rent the songs for the next 7 days, or preview the content for 30 days. Select the "Preview" tab, and then use the selections for each song to choose which songs to load previews for. Confirm the usage at the bottom is as expected, and then click "Continue" to spend those previews.

Processing Time for Playback Rental Previews
Rental Previews are processed similarly to full Playback Rentals; They're processed individually per song for each customer a single time for each customer. When previewing the song again in the future, no processing will be required. Typical processing time for a Playback Preview is 3-6 minutes, but may be longer on peak times.


How to use Rental Previews in Playback

Once loaded into Playback, Rental Previews can be used just like any other song track, to plan your setlist including; transitions, automations, mix settings, arrangement, and more!

Click and Guide Fader Restrictions

The click and guide tracks cannot be muted, and the Click bus and guide volume controls are restricted to 50%-100% volume. This is an intentional restriction when using a Playback Rental Preview.

Note: Saving the setlist or named arrangement with a Playback Rental preview will also save the click and guide fader mix in it's state to that setlist or arrangement.

Unlocking the full Playback Rental from the Rental Preview

When ready to rent the song after the rental preview is loaded, enter Setlist Edit mode, open the song edit menu, and select the "Rentals" tab and then the "Rent" button in the top-right of the song's edit menu. After confirmation, this will then spend the rental to unlock the full song with no limitations on that specific device for 7 days.
